Abstract
Wireless networks are widely used in urban or office environments and are increasingly considered as an attractive solution for various aeronautic applications. Current investigations focus in particular on RFID technologies because of their widespread use, low cost and ease of installation. The question of the optimal positioning of transmitters and receivers checking all industrial constraints arises during the design phase. Numerical modelling appears as a powerful way to assess this optimization step. The objective of this paper is thus to present a methodology to predict performances of RFID systems in complex aeronautic environments.
